Nissan is all set to bring its X-Trail SUV to the Indian market. Ahead of its launch, the brand has released the teaser for the upcoming X-Trail. The fourth-gen model was previously showcased in November 2022 alongside Juke and Qashqai which are also expected to arrive in India.
Those who are not aware, the X-Trail is not a completely new model from the brand coming to India. It was on sale here in its first and second generation. The third-gen SUV was showcased a few years back, though never went on sale officially. The fourth-gen model has been on sale globally since 2021 and is now coming to India.
The X-Trail SUV will be imported as a CBU (Completely Built Unit) under the government policy. It is said that up to 2,500 vehicles will be imported per year without the need for homologation.
From the design perspective, the SUV features large V-motion front grille and split headligh set-up. Besides, the X-Trail has body creases, making it look sharp.
The X-Trail is likely to have a large floating touchscreen infotainment unit, a digital instrument cluster, an electronic parking brake with auto-hold, a Boss sound system, 3-spoke multifunction steering wheel, a 10.8-inch head-up display, automatic climate control and ADAS.
As for the powertrain, Nissan will offer a 1.5-litre, 3-cylinder turbo petrol engine. Mated with CVT, this engine can deliver 201 bhp of power with 305 Nm of torque.
Upon launch, it will take likes on the Volkswagen Tiguan, Hyundai Tucson, Skoda Kodiaq, Citroen C5, and Jeep Compass.
